66n. Cordilleran area from Glacier Lake near the head of the Saskatchewan River (Ordovician of Canada)

Also known as 255’ from Mons summit

Where: Alberta, Canada (51.9° N, 116.9° W: paleocoordinates 2.2° S, 72.6° W)

• coordinate estimated from map

• outcrop-level geographic resolution

When: Gasconadian (485.4 - 477.7 Ma)

• Walcott gave this as the Mons formation: outdated. This is from the upper 50 ft of the formation in this section

• group of beds-level stratigraphic resolution

Environment/lithology: gray limestone

• thin-bedded gray limestone

Size class: macrofossils

Preservation: cast

Reposited in the USNM
